What You’ll Do
- Lead the front-of-house team during service and set a positive, upbeat tone
- Guide your crew on the floor, helping them solve small issues in the moment
- Support training and onboarding for new team members
- Keep daily operations smooth by checking setups, stock, cleanliness and safety. You know everything about the daily opening and closing tasks.
- You lead the team with a helicopter view. Staying present on the floor, looking forward to what needs to be done and arranging it accordingly. You chat with members and jump in to support the team whenever and wherever is needed.
- Handle transactions accurately and pass on any irregularities
- Kick off and recap the shifts: Inform the team of the goals and structure for the shift, if we are out of stock of any items, and motivate the team.
- Work closely with the kitchen and bar teams to keep service flowing. With the housekeeping team keeping the place looking spotless and the Membership team to maintain a knowledge and understanding of our members.
- Report maintenance issues and operational concerns to the technical department and management, if required.
- Recognize and greet our members by name, remembering what they like to order the stories they have told you and ensure high member satisfaction. You ensure VIP guests get extra special attention and treatment.
- Handle guest complaints professionally and resolve problems quickly.
- You are the product expert. You know your wine from your beers from your cocktails and the food menu inside out.
- You set the mood of the shift, personally through your work ethic, body language and mood and professionally through the lighting, music, and tempo.
- Follow and uphold hotel service, food and beverage quality and grooming standards.
What You’ll Have
- You have 1-2 years of experience in a Supervisory role
- You bring confidence leading a team during service
- You communicate clearly and directly and stay calm when things get busy
- You have an eye for detail and keep service consistent
- You bring genuine hospitality energy and enjoy being guest-facing
- You work well with different teams and lead by example
- You act like an owner.
- You manage the staff costs of the shift and send people home early if needed.
- You speak English and ideally some Dutch. Extra languages are a bonus
